Joseph Eugene Smith, age 66 of Carroll, Ohio passed away on Tuesday, January 1, 2013. He was born November 26, 1946 to Walter and Vivian Smith in Columbus, Ohio. Joseph was a highly decorated veteran proudly serving in the United States Army during the Vietnam War. He worked at A.E.P. as a machinist for 42 years and was serving as a Bloom Township Trustee in his 28th year. Joseph had several memberships including V.F.W. Post #7941, Bloom Township Fire Department and E.M.S, American Legion Post #677 and Lithopolis Methodist Church. His hobbies included hunting, fishing, working in the yard and most of all, spending quality time with his grandchildren and family.

He is preceded in death by his father, Walter Page.

Survivors include his loving wife of 35 years, Patricia Smith; daughter, Kerri Balog; son, Jason (Amber) Smith; two grandchildren, Mikaylie Smith and Austin Smith; mother, Vivian Smith; sister, Marilyn (Gary) Ripley; brother, Gary (Avis) Smith; two nieces, Susan Ripley and Theresa (Scott) Richardson; nephew, Scott Smith; and several cousins.
